WashMetrix

Status: Complete

WashMetrix is a premier business intelligence platform designed to give car wash operators a true, real-time view of their P&L and operational performance. Recognizing its potential to disrupt a legacy industry, 2 the Moon Ventures took an active role in the company’s flight path, providing both capital and strategic advisory services. We focused on:

  • Propelling Market Share: Engineered the go-to-market strategy to dominate the sector.
  • Operational Fuel: Built the sales infrastructure required for rapid scaling.
  • Final Orbit: Navigated the roadmap leading to a successful exit.

WashMetrix successfully completed its flight with a 100% acquisition by Sonny’s Enterprises, cementing its legacy as a cornerstone of the world’s largest car wash network.

Parkhub

Status: Complete

ParkHub is a premier parking technology provider that transformed a fragmented, analog industry into a data-driven ecosystem. George Baker Sr. founded the company and originally boot-strapped it financially. Over a decade-long trajectory, ParkHub navigated three sophisticated private equity rounds to achieve market dominance. Key aspects of the mission include:

  • System Architecture: Pioneered hardware and software integration for real-time parking intelligence.
  • Staged Ignition: Managed multiple rounds of private equity to fuel aggressive expansion.
  • Final Stage Separation: Executed a high-velocity dual-merger with JustPark to create a global powerhouse.

ParkHub successfully completed its primary mission with a strategic exit, while George remains on the flight deck as a Director to ensure the company’s continued trajectory as the world’s leading parking management platform.
